Josh Homme, Grace Jones, Slash And Everybody Else Is In The Silent Film 'Gutterdammerung'

Do you know what would happen if the almighty guitar was taken away from Earth? There would be no sex, no drugs, and definitely no rock and roll. At least that’s the truth according to Gutterdämmerung, an upcoming black-and-white silent film created and directed by Belgian-Swedish visual artist and music video director Bjorn Tagemose.

It would take a truly epic cast to bring this grand tale to life, and that’s exactly what Tagemose has assembled: Starring in the movie are Iggy Pop, Henry Rollins, Eagles of Death Metal’s Josh Homme and Jesse Hughes, Grace Jones, Lemmy from Motörhead, Mark Lanegan, Justice, Slash, and others.

According to the film’s official summary:

“The film is set in a world where God has saved the world from sin by taking from mankind the Devil’s ‘Grail of Sin’…..the Evil Guitar. The Earth has now turned into a puritan world where there is no room for sex, drugs or rock ‘n’ roll.


From up on high in heaven a “punk-angel”, Vicious (portrayed by Iggy Pop), looks upon the world with weary bored eyes. Behind God’s back, Vicious sends the Devil’s guitar back to earth and sin in all its forms returns to mankind.


An evil puritan priest (Henry Rollins) manipulates a naive girl to retrieve the guitar and destroy it. On her quest to find the Devil’s Grail Of Sin, the girl is forced to face the world’s most evil rock and roll bastards. Throughout her journey, she has a rival in the form of a rock chick determined to stop her from destroying the instrument.”
